The defect
Due to a software issue, the driver side window’s automatic protection system may not operate as intended and result in the window closing with excessive force on any obstruction such as a body part.
The hazard
If a body part is in the window space when the driver's side window is closing, it can increase the risk of injury to a vehicle occupant.
The remedy
Owners of affected vehicles will be contacted in writing by Tesla. To address the issue, an over the air software update (OTA) update will be installed on all affected vehicles which does not require a service appointment.If your vehicle is running software version 2025.26.6 or later, your vehicle is not subject to this issue. You can confirm your vehicle’s software version by tapping 'Controls' > 'Software’ on your touchscreen.
